NCT04394208: SCOPE
Silymarin in COVID-19 Pneumonia
Phase 3 trial testing Silymarin in COVID-19 in 50 participants. Status unknown.

Who can join
18 and older, any sex, with COVID-19 or Viral Pneumonia Human Coronavirus. Patients with the condition only — healthy volunteers not accepted.
Sponsor's own description
A randomized placebo controlled trial to assess the clinical outcome in COVID-19 Pneumonia following administration of Silymarin owing to its role as a p38 MAPK pathway inhibitor and its antiviral, anti-inflammatory and anti-oxidant effects
